Implicit FrontEnd provides deep integration with Microsoft Outlook. In addition to full two-way synchronization of Outlook data such as contacts and calendars, it allows you to sync CRM data including accounts, opportunities, quotes etc. so that you can do all your CRM work without leaving Outlook. In addition, FrontEnd allows you to leverage the rich Outlook functionality to provide tools such as manual and automatic email archiving, collaboration and approval, opportunity tracking and more.

  5. Implicit member avatar

    Implicit Inc. Provider

    3 years ago

    Hi,

    Please ask your IT person to do the following:

    1. Uninstall FrontEnd.
    2. Go to Windows control panel, select the mail application and create a new profile. Then add the mailbox you want to use to this new profile and make it default.
    3. Install FrontEnd and launch Outlook
    4. FrontEnd will use the desired profile. Go through the configuration
    5. After configuring FrontEnd, you can go back to control panel and add the other mailbox to the profile.

    Rest assure that it works!
